搜外问答的网站库功能怎样写
搜外问答是一个强大的问答平台,提供了丰富的功能以满足用户的需求。下面将从几个方面介绍搜外问答网站库的功能。
1. 问题发布
搜外问答允许用户发布问题并提供详细的问题描述。用户可以在发布问题时选择问题的分类,这有助于问题被正确归类从而提高问题解答的准确性。用户还可以添加标签以便其他用户更方便地搜索相关问题。
2. 问题搜索
搜外问答提供了强大的问题搜索功能,用户可以根据关键字、标签和分类来搜索问题。这使得用户能够快速找到自己感兴趣的问题,并获得相关的解答。
3. 回答问题
任何用户都可以回答其他用户的问题。搜外问答以开放的方式鼓励用户分享自己的知识和经验,从而促进互相学习和交流。用户可以对问题的回答进行点赞和评论,这有助于其他用户评估回答的质量。
4. 问答排序
搜外问答根据一定的算法对问题和回答进行排序,确保用户能够先看到最相关和最有价值的内容。这样可以提高用户的浏览体验,同时也更加公平地展现用户的贡献。
5. 个人中心
搜外问答为用户提供了个人中心,用户可以在其中管理自己发布的问题和回答。个人中心还提供了用户的个人资料和积分等信息,让用户更好地了解自己在搜外问答的活动情况。
搜外问答网站库怎写?
搭建搜外问答网站库需要一定的技术支持和数据存储能力。以下是一些基本的步骤和技术要点:
1. 选择适合的开发语言和框架,例如使用Python和Django等框架来搭建网站。
2. 设计数据库模式,包括问题、回答、用户和标签等表的结构和关系。
3. 开发前端页面,包括问题发布、搜索、回答等功能的界面设计和交互逻辑。
4. 编写后端代码,实现问题发布、搜索、回答等功能的业务逻辑,并与数据库进行交互。
5. 部署网站,选择适合的服务器和域名,确保网站能够稳定运行。
搜外问答网站库的编写涉及到多个方面的知识和技术,需要综合运用前端开发、后端开发、数据库设计等技能。同时,还需要关注网站的用户体验,保证功能的易用性和稳定性。只有如此,搜外问答才能成为一个真正受用户喜爱的问答平台。